Transaction

720ea2da4ff86e36d8e5272aee0162312c28d3675ae2ac9dbfe05048470a4e30
397,651 confirmations
Timestamp
1535338178
Block538,655
Fee19,782 sats
Fee rate40.5 sats/vB
view on mempool.space

Inputs & Outputs